WMSC/Freestyle Club let you try before you buy

Both the Whistler Mountain Ski Club and the Blackcomb Freestyle Ski Club are offering open houses to the general public, giving young skiers an opportunity to try these sports out for themselves.

The WMSC Rookie Camp takes place this weekend, Nov. 27-28, and is open to all skiers born between the years of 1990 and 1994. The cost is $25, which includes two days of coaching in freeskiing, jumping and gate training.

The Blackcomb Freestyle Ski Club is hosting a free one-day trial to anyone on Dec. 4. Just sign a waiver and you can join either a moguls camp or a freeskiing camp for a day with no commitment to join the club. The club is also offering passes this season worth anywhere from four days to 15 days of coaching at a special rate, if you don’t have the time to make a full commitment or want to use coaching to improve your their mogul skiing or park riding.
